Is there a significant difference between the following two configurations,
i.e. are there certain elements to consider in choosing one over the other?
1.
{code:xml}
<AppenderRef ref="out">
<ThresholdFilter level="anyValidLevel"/>
</AppenderRef>
{code}
2.
{code:xml}
<AppenderRef ref="out" level="anyValidLevel"/>
{code}
I noticed the methods isFilteredByAppenderControl() and isFilteredByLevel() in
class AppenderControl are annotated with @PerformanceSensitive, but I don't
know if that's relevant.
